North Mankato Minnesota Weather Trends

North Mankato Precipitation

With North Mankato receiving 41.42 inches of precipitation in the last year, it falls below the national average of 50.61 inches but above Minnesota’s average of 37.31 inches. North Mankato’s UV Rating

North Mankato’s average UV rating of 3.8 is slightly lower than the national average of 4.29 but higher than Minnesota’s average of 3.6. Additionally, the average max UV rating of 4.04 in North Mankato offers ample sunlight for solar panels to operate efficiently. North Mankato’s Cloud Cover

With an average cloud cover of 44%, North Mankato experiences slightly less cloudiness compared to both the national average of 44.46% and Minnesota’s average of 48.96%. This means that there are plenty of clear days for your solar panels to capture sunlight and generate electricity. North Mankato Minnesota Electricity Costs

North Mankato residents pay around $0.14/kw for electricity, which is higher than the national average of $0.13/kw but on par with Minnesota’s average.
